2 苍何fly

尚未进行身份认证

我欲高飞九天揽明月

等级
TA的排名 3w+

穿透内网将外部的请求转发到本地

在调试微信、支付宝、企业微信回调调时候,如何进行本地debug呢?这就需要用到一个工具:WeNAT能够将外部的请求转发到本地,下载后https://www.wezoz.com,直接按照说明配置本地服务端口号就可以得到域名不管在postman还是服务器回调都可以在本地测试了,相当于8把自己本地的服务提供给别人,是不是特别很方便呢?get新技能。...

2020-04-01 22:00:39

疫情之下我是如何大胆跳槽的

一、前言一场突如其来的疫情打乱了很多人的计划,起初没有人在意,直到这场灾难和每个人息息相关。企业停工,招聘也随之缩减,别说招聘,有些企业甚至开始了裁员;这个时候。很多人并不愿意冒险离职去寻求新的工作机会,这也会导致招聘市场上放出的岗位很少。从二月初开始关注招聘市场,在java工程师这块的深圳招聘数目并不多。但逆境中总有机遇,就像巴菲特所说“众人贪婪时我恐惧,众人恐惧时我贪婪”。二月初开始...

2020-03-29 00:38:17

calling prepareStatement is no longer allowed! Increase reapTimeout to avoid this problem

异常: 2020-01-09 18:30:48.072 ERROR 10212 — [nio-8080-exec-2] o.a.c.c.C.[.[.[/].[dispatcherServlet] : Servlet.service() for servlet [dispatcherServlet] in context with path [] threw exception [Request p...

2020-03-26 14:22:35

熟悉mac'电脑进行开发

一、前言由于公司的开发全部基于mac进行开发,对于常年使用windows进行开发的我来说确实较为不习惯。从mac的键盘鼠标和键盘和windows的都有很大的不同,软件的下载和安装也不同,还有分屏的概念等。下面就我这些天了解的知识做一个总结。二、认识Mac OSMac OS是一套运行于苹果Macintosh系列电脑上的操作系统。Mac OS是首个在商用领域成功的图形用户界面操作系统。现行的...

2020-03-19 12:56:25

找不到问题在哪,不妨删掉代码在哪里重新黏贴

一个比较老的项目,给同事部署本地环境的时候,出现pom依赖死活导入不进来的问题,所有条件都排查了,都和我一样,最后把代码删了再黏贴就好了!一个教训...

2020-03-10 12:10:18

按照顺序添加到单链表

实际开发中的一个需求:客户端和服务端约定:客户端给到几个用户给到服务端,用户有用户编号,姓名等属性,现在客户端需要服务端返回按照用户编号从小到大的顺序返回给客户端,比如客户端给的是8.6.10.1,需要服务端返回的是1.6.8.10,不能将数据保存在库中后再按顺序取出。可以考虑用单链表的形式,按照顺序添加,这样在内存中已经操作,速度很快。一、链表链表是有序的列表,以节点的方式存储,每个节点...

2020-02-05 17:02:52

java将二维数组转为稀疏数组保存到本地并读取本地文件转为二维数组

package sparsearray;import java.io.*;public class SparseArray { public static void main(String[] args) { //创建一个原始的二维数组11*11 //0表示没有棋子,1表示黑棋,2表示白棋 int[][] chessArr1 = n...

2020-02-05 16:26:00

利用数组实现环形队列

package queue;import java.util.Scanner;public class CircleArrayQueueDemo { public static void main(String[] args) { //测试一把 System.out.println("测试数组模拟环形队列的案例~~~"); // 创建一个环形队列 CircleArr...

2020-02-05 15:44:59

Java工程师面试必问的基础知识整理(超详细)

前言最近又重新复习了一遍java基础知识,做了一下整理。这些知识点大部分为面试必问,建议收藏。在理解的基础上进行记忆会更深刻,推荐用自己语言组织归纳,这样面试官认为你至少还是知道这个知识点的。直接上干货!目录一、java的跨平台原理二、冒泡排序三、比较排序四、插入排序五、for、while、do-while区别六、continue、break、return的异同七、==与e...

2019-11-18 13:03:01

Maven依赖管理

一、什么是Mavenmaven是一个管理依赖的工具,我们项目中常用maven来管理jar包,并且可以管理jar包的依赖,有了maven,无论是引用别人的jar包还是自己项目需要打 包都变得极其简单。maven仓库就是存放jar包的仓库,分为本地库、远程库和私有库。本地库是本地计算机存放jar包的地方,本地仓库需要到私有库去拉取jar包,私有库一般是公司自己存放jar的仓库,会有专门的人员进行...

2019-11-10 17:04:53

Linux操作系统

一、Linux概述Linux和Windows均属于操作系统的范畴,和windows不同的是,他没有像Windows有图形化界面,可以鼠标点点点,Linux所有操作都是命令行操作,Linux不同于Windows,是个开源的操作系统,全世界有很多的开发者都参与到Linux的建设中。Linux可安装在各种计算机硬件设备中,比如手机、平板电脑、路由器、台式计算机。Linux是由芬兰赫尔辛基大学学生L...

2019-11-10 16:11:23

1024——论代码日志的重要性

今天是2019年的1024,又是一个程序猿的节日,我深深记得去年的今天,我还在为mysql连接不上的问题而困扰了很久,而如今,却应为,少打印日志导致一个问题定位了很久很久。今晚也是加班上线,一切正常仿佛没往日上线那般轻松,调用其他接口的时候报错,以为是代码问题,定位由于没有打印调用的URL导致没有把问题想到是因为URL不对。之前已经在配置中心修改,习惯性的以为配置已经生效,原来配置还没有生效。...

2019-10-24 23:32:24

springboot与缓存(整合redis)

一、什么是缓存缓存就是数据交换的缓冲区(称作:Cache),他把一些外存上的数据保存在内存上,为什么保存在内存上,我们运行的所有程序里面的变量都是存放在内存中的,所以如果想将值放入内存上,可以通过变量的方式存储。在JAVA中一些缓存一般都是通过Map集合来实现的。缓存在不同的场景下,作用是不一样的具体举例说明:✔ 操作系统磁盘缓存 ——> 减少磁盘机械操作。✔ 数据库缓存——&g...

2019-09-01 13:51:14

应用容器引擎——Docker

一、前言在计算机技术日新月异的今天, Docker 在国内发展的如火如荼。特别是在一线互联网公司 Docker 的使用是十分普遍的,甚至成为了一些企业面试的加分项,不信的话看看下面这张图。这是在某招聘网站上看到的招聘 Java 开发工程师的招聘要求,其中有一条熟悉 Docker 成为了你快速入职的加分项,由此可见熟悉 Docker 在互联网公司的地位之重要。Docker相关视频教程下载:...

2019-08-31 15:13:11

java在过滤器中为http请求加请求头header

前言现在有一个需求场景是,每一个请求我都需要在请求头里面加上token这个请求头,作为一种校验机制,传统的接口可以通过设置一个全局的变量,然后通过页面携带过来(大概就是先将我们的token放在session中,写一个服务用来获取session中的token,然后主页面用ajax调用接口,将token放在隐藏域中,然后将请求头放进来,用ajax方法,这里不想洗说了),但是有一种情况是通过页面传递的...

2019-08-13 21:34:40

springboot系列知识

前言Spring Boot都很熟悉了,再重新认识学习一遍。一、Spring Boot 入门Build Anything with Spring Boot:Spring Boot is the starting point for building all Spring-based applications. Spring Boot is designed to get you up and...

2019-08-11 22:59:00

hexo博客结合百度语音合成为你的博客添加欢迎语音

前言今晚在知乎和CSDN看文章时都发现了文章有点击即可朗读,将文字转换成语音,虽然机器音很严重,但可以将这个用来做个人博客的一个欢迎语。也就是别人点击你博客进入的时候会自动播放这个欢迎语,有点像是你去商店买东西,迎接你的小姐姐说的“欢迎您光临本店”。是不是很炫酷?当有人访问你博客的时候,欢迎提示语。具体效果请点击(在PC端才会自动播放,客户端目前不支持自动播放,但是可以手动点击左下角的播放按...

2019-07-14 02:55:22

计算机学习资料(全)——含视频资料

一、前言内容涵盖开发所需工具如eclipse、idea、maven、MySQL等、Java开发学习视频,包含多家培训机构内部视频,以及网络直播视频等,整理不易,还请点个赞再走吧!所有资源均为互联网收集以及其他途径获取,非商业用途,如有侵权, 请联系作者删除,谢谢!资料会持续更新,欢迎在GitHub上更进,或者微信公众号或者博主个人博客或关注博主CSDN博客查看最新资料;我的GitHub微...

2019-07-14 00:12:22

搭建GitHub免费个人网站(详细教程)

layout: posttitle: hexo在GitHub上搭建个人博客date: 2019-07-10 21:25:30categories:搭建个人博客keywords:hexo,nexttags:- hexo- github博客一、前言1、欢迎访问最新版博客:https://freestylefly.github.io//2、主要含:搭建个人博客详细步骤,hexo...

2019-07-10 22:54:43

win10环境下MySql(8.0.16最新版本)安装过程以及遇到的问题

一、前言买了新的台式机,装了win10操作系统,打算本地安装mysql,由于之前一直用的win7,且用的mysql版本是比较老的,现在打算安装官网最新的版本8.0.16,记录一下安装过程和遇到的坑。二、mysql的彻底卸载在安装新版本前,先要彻底卸载本机上安装的其他版本,这个地方由于我没卸载C:\ProgramData\MySQL文件夹在安装新版本的时候会报这个异常Hostname Por...

2019-06-23 00:29:34

查看更多

勋章 我的勋章
  • GitHub
    GitHub
    绑定GitHub第三方账户获取
  • 签到达人
    签到达人
    累计签到获取,不积跬步,无以至千里,继续坚持!
  • 技术圈认证
    技术圈认证
    用户完成年度认证,即可获得
  • 推荐红人
    推荐红人
    发布高质量Blink获得高赞和评论,进入推荐栏目即可获得
  • 阅读者勋章Lv1
    阅读者勋章Lv1
    授予在CSDN APP累计阅读博文达到3天的你,是你的坚持与努力,使你超越了昨天的自己。
  • 专栏达人
    专栏达人
    授予成功创建个人博客专栏的用户。专栏中添加五篇以上博文即可点亮!撰写博客专栏浓缩技术精华,专栏达人就是你!
  • 持之以恒
    持之以恒
    授予每个自然月内发布4篇或4篇以上原创或翻译IT博文的用户。不积跬步无以至千里,不积小流无以成江海,程序人生的精彩需要坚持不懈地积累!
  • 1024勋章
    1024勋章
    #1024程序员节#活动勋章,当日发布原创博客即可获得
  • 勤写标兵Lv1
    勤写标兵Lv1
    授予每个自然周发布1篇到3篇原创IT博文的用户。本勋章将于次周周三上午根据用户上周的博文发布情况由系统自动颁发。
  • 学习力
    学习力
    参与《原力计划【第二季】— 学习力挑战》获得推荐的原创文章的博主